Although creativity is innate, there are some simple tips to follow when redesigning your home. Next time your New York living space is in need of a makeover, be sure to follow these simple rules:

  • Add plenty of light: Lighting can make or break a room. Many homes are exquisitely decorated but look too dark and dingy because their space doesn't receive enough natural light. If this is the case in your home, be sure to use sheer draperies, which are not only stylish but can also allow sunlight to flourish.
  • Buy staple furniture pieces: "Resist overcrowding a room. Gracious living means space to maneuver with ease," writes Houzz.com contributor Judith Taylor. "You don't need to fill up a space with lots of furniture. Spend more of your budget on fewer but better-quality pieces, and your room will look better than if it's stuffed to the gills with flea market finds."
  • Have a focal point: It's important to have a focal point to base your design scheme around. Successful interiors are neither too cluttered nor too bare. Your focal point will attract your guest's eyes, without taking too much attention away from the remainder of the room. For an example, some homeowners base their rooms around a signature furniture piece like an oversized couch. Others opt to make a dazzling piece of artwork the main focus, or draw attention to beautiful bay windows. The choice is up to you!
